Circle K Raises €32,400 For Jack & Jill Children’s Foundation

Circle K announced today that its Christmas charity initiative has raised €32,400 in funds for the Jack & Jill Children’s Foundation.

The Jack & Jill Children’s Foundation is a charity that funds and delivers specialist home nursing and end-of-life care for children from birth to six years of age who have highly complex and life-limiting medical conditions.

The initiative, which took place at sites nationwide (excluding Circle K Express), saw €1 from every car wash purchased between 19 and 24 December donated to the children’s charity.

Through the support of Circle K customers and colleagues, the funds raised will provide 1,800 hours of home nursing care to the 412 children currently under the care of the Jack & Jill Children’s Foundation across the country.
